IEA's (@iea.org) Global Energy Review 2026 is out! Solar PV is leading the charge—supplying over 25% of global energy demand growth, ahead of natural gas at 17%. For the first time, a renewable source is the top driver of demand growth. ☀️🔌💡 #Solar #Renewables

The final agreement - adopted with significant delay - include three elements that increase the policy uncertainty in EU climate policy:
• backdoors to revisit the target
• unspecified flexibilities (CDR & international credits)
• conditionalities for the upcoming reforms of policy instruments
